In the small room, Aiden was resting on his bed, eyes closed. He was recuperating currently. He wasn't bloody or bruised, but he was mentally tired.
'Making sure you only defend and disarm your opponent during a battle is more taxing than I have thought.' he sighed wearily.
He was tired, but, at the same time, he was extremely happy. He banished 2 more Nightmare spawns, and resolved the issue with her mother and father, thus making progress. His quest objective indicator showed a proud 3 instead of the previous 1.

Back about an hour ago…
"Pesky brat, who do you think you are to lecture me?! I'm not gonna stand for it anymore!"
The man bellowed and as he stood up, he pushed the middle-aged woman, the mother to the side.
"Get out of my way! I will show him today that he shouldn't have messed with us!"
"Don't do it!"
"SILENCE!"
*SLAP*
With a loud slap, he silenced the woman who was now on the ground with reddened cheeks, on the verge of crying because of frustration, sadness, and worry. She didn't know what was happening to her husband, he never acted this way, aggression was something he detested all his life. Now suddenly being so overly aggressive, was very out-of-character for him. Yet, she couldn't do a thing.
"Aiden just run! Don't let him get to you!" she shouted at the boy.
Aiden, who was standing and facing the slowly approaching raging bull of a man, smiled and while not taking off his focus of the threat, he calmly said.
"Don't worry, mother. I am more than enough to handle him. Rest assured nobody will get hurt, and I will force him to regain his senses."
Hearing his words, her mother wasn't sure how to react. He felt the confidence in his voice, and while she couldn't believe it, she couldn't help but nod her head.
At the same time, his father, upon hearing his words, he felt his rage soar even higher than before.
"How dare you still look down on me?! You can 'handle' me? We will see about that!"
As he was already in front of the boy, he suddenly swung the knife towards Aiden's throat.
While the speed his father used was higher than the average human of this world, it was still like slow-motion in Aiden's eyes.

'I guess his strength and speed have increased because of the Nightmare. No matter, it is still a far cry from me. I will have to make sure to not hurt him, and just tire him before I disarm him. I have to shake his will to have any chance on waking him up.'
Looking at the approaching blade, Aiden simply leaned back avoiding it by a hair's breadth.
Seeing how easily his attack was avoided the man growled in anger and stroke again, drawing a horizontal arc around Aiden's chest area.
Aiden once again, simply leaned slightly to the back, using minimal effort to once again, barely avoid the tip of the blade.
Cutting nothing but air once again, the middle-aged man grew frustrated.
"STOP DODGING! FACE ME LIKE A MAN!" he bellowed.
His next attack was a thrust, once again around the middle of Aiden's chest.
The attack was, once again, only met air, as Aiden leaned to the side, still not left his original position.
Frustration bubbling in the middle-aged men, he repeatedly slashed and thrust with his knife, only to cut, slice, and thrust the air each and every time.
As time passed, so did the limited stamina the middle-aged man was blessed with. The slices lost their power and the thrusts became weaker, but no matter how hard he tried, he never managed to cause any harm.
"ARGH! I CAN'T EVEN DO THIS RIGHT!" finally the frustration reached its peak, and while dropping the knife, he also fell to the ground. His frustration slowly turned to silent sobs, as he buried his face into his hands.
"I'M A FAILURE! I'M NOTHING BUT A FAILURE!" He cried out. Raising his head slightly, he looked at the knife on the ground, and as a dark thought crossed his troubled mind, he suddenly reached out for it.
"I DON'T DESERVE ANY OF YOU. I'M A FAILURE OF A MAN AND AS A FATHER!" with that he thrust towards his heart hoping to end his bleak existence.
However, suddenly his hand met some resistance, and his thrust was halted midway through. He opened up his eyes only to see his son's gently smiling face looking at him. At the side, his wife was silently sobbing her left cheek still red from his earlier slap.
"No, Father. You are not a failure. You are just a bit lost. Yes, you may have met an obstacle, but that just means you have to try harder. You have a loving family, a kind wife, and a loving son that looks up to you. Please, come back to us, don't let darkness cloud your heart any longer!"

As he looked at the honest and gentle smile and heard his pure words, the middle-aged man's heart trembled. Slowly cracks appeared around the invisible barrier that the Nightmare had on it, and as the warmth returned to it, so did the cracks widen only to eventually shatter.
The moment the Nightmare's hold was shattered from his heart and as the warmth returned to it, so did the realization of what he just did. His face contorted to pain, and he continued sobbing while he looked at his wife.
"Honey, please forgive me, I… I don't know why I hit you. I...I…"
He couldn't continue as the woman put his finger on his lips sealing it.
"Shhh! I know dear, I felt the same just a little while ago. It was our son that freed me, just like you."
He looked at Aiden, not sure what and how to say. He stuttered.
"Son, I… I… don't…"
Aiden raised his palm in the air, silencing him. As he stood up, he calmly said.
"Don't worry about it, I know you weren't yourself. Try to rest up, and don't let yourself fall into the same 'pit' again. Okay?"
Unable to say anything, the man weakly nodded his head, and looked at his sons receding back as he left the kitchen going to his room.
Only after he went into this room did he manage to look back at his wife, who was still smiling at him.
"He is so much stronger than before…"
The middle-aged woman smiled at his words. Her arms around his neck, she rested her head on his shoulders.
"I know honey. He is incredible…"
---
Back in the room, Aiden was currently resting. With another problem solved, he was satisfied with the results. Sure, things escalated a bit, and it got to a point he didn't anticipate, in the end, everything turned just right.
The problem was that it took out more of him than Aiden expected. Even though he didn't have any familial feelings towards these 2, they were still his parents, and as it turns out, it was hard for him to fight off the attacks of his Nightmare-crazed father.
'*Huaaah* At least this part is over. I still don't know how this story should end. We'll see how the day and most likely this story ends at that party tonight. I still have a few hours before it, so let's rest a bit.' Yawning he turned to his side. Closing his weary eyes, he soon drifted to sleep.
